    About Izjah

    Izjah offers a fresh, contemporary take on a deeply spiritual heritage, ideal for parents seeking a name that feels both distinct and meaningful. With its Hebrew roots signifying "Gift of God," it carries a profound message without sounding overly traditional. The phonetic spelling "IZ-jah" gives it an accessible, modern sound, yet it remains wonderfully rare, ensuring your child will likely be the only Izjah in their class. This name bridges ancient faith with a forward-thinking sensibility, perfect for families who value individuality and a connection to their spiritual lineage.
